《Visual FoxPro数据库编程实例手册》PDF下载

  • 购买积分:14 如何计算积分?
  • 作  者:曾刚主编
  • 出 版 社:北京:海洋出版社
  • 出版年份:2006
  • ISBN:7502765247
  • 页数:429 页
图书介绍:本书介绍Visual FoxPro的功能,以具体实例进行讲解,可作为速成教材及自学手册。

目录 1

第1篇 数据库开发必备知识 1

第1章 开始使用Visual FoxPro 1

1.1 建立数据库管理系统“项目” 2

1.2 分析应用软件系统 3

1.3 建立数据库 5

1.4 设计并制作表 7

1.5 确定字段类型 9

1.6 定义字段 10

1.7 输入数据记录 12

1.8 快速浏览数据表结构 14

1.9 修改数据表结构 14

1.10 排序字段 16

1.11 更名数据表 17

1.12 使用“表向导”建立数据表 18

1.13 专家指点 21

1.14 思考题 21

2.1 启动浏览窗口 22

第2章 浏览与修改数据记录 22

2.2 修改数据记录 24

2.3 查找记录行与定位“指针” 24

2.4 定位“指针”位置 25

2.5 添加记录 26

2.6 删除记录 27

2.7 控制使用“浏览窗口”的网格线 28

2.8 改变各栏的显示宽度 29

2.10 分离“浏览窗口” 31

2.9 分裂“浏览窗口” 31

2.11 专家指点 32

2.12 思考题 33

第3章 设计与应用“查询” 34

3.1 启动“查询” 34

3.2 选择查询字段 36

3.3 筛选查询记录 37

3.4 排序查询结果 38

3.5 保存查询 39

3.7 将“查询”加入“项目”中 40

3.6 应用“查询” 40

3.8 使用“查询设计器”设计“查询” 41

3.9 在“查询设计器”中选择查询字段 42

3.10 在“查询设计器”中加入数据表与字段 42

3.11 预览查询 44

3.12 设置查询的输出形式 44

3.13 浏览“查询” 46

3.14 专家指点 46

3.15 思考题 47

第4章 设计与使用“表单” 48

4.1 启动“表单向导” 48

4.2 在“表单向导”中选择字段 50

4.3 在Form Wizard中设计表单外观 51

4.4 排序表单中的数据 51

4.5 保存与预览表单 52

4.6 运行表单 53

4.7 快速创建表单 54

4.8 应用表单 57

4.10 思考题 58

4.9 专家指点 58

第5章 设计与应用“报表” 59

5.1 设计报表 59

5.2 保存与预览“报表” 64

5.3 浏览与打印“报表” 65

5.4 使用“快速报表”功能 66

5.5 浏览与打印“快速报表” 68

5.6 专家指点 69

5.7 思考题 69

6.1 查看“表达式”的值 70

第6章 使用表达式 70

6.2 使用“操作符” 72

6.3 专家指点 75

6.4 思考题 75

第7章 使用Visual FoxPro命令 76

7.1 执行Visual FoxPro命令 76

7.2 设置窗口的使用方式 80

7.3 运行MS-DOS命令与外部程序 81

7.4 快速建立数据表 82

7.5 快速建立数据表与字段 84

7.6 专家指点 85

7.7 思考题 86

第8章 使用“索引” 87

8.1 使用“表设计器”建立“索引” 87

8.2 使用INDEX命令定义索引 89

8.3 使用INDEX命令制定筛选条件 91

8.4 INDEX命令的参数 91

8.5 排序记录顺序 92

8.6 使用SORT命令排序记录 93

8.7 专家指点 94

8.8 思考题 95

第2篇 关系数据库中的典型关系运用 96

第9章 建立与使用关系数据库 96

9.1 使用“关系数据库” 97

9.2 打开关系数据表 97

9.3 使用“数据工作期” 99

9.4 使用“索引”浏览记录 100

9.5 准备定义数据关系 103

9.6 定义关联表 103

9.7 创建“一对多”关系 104

9.8 浏览关系数据表 105

9.9 专家指点 106

9.10 思考题 106

第10章 设计与使用“一对多查询” 108

10.1 设计关系数据库“查询” 108

10.2 指定“一对多”查询字段 109

10.3 定义表间的关系 110

10.4 排序记录与预览查询 111

10.5 设计对多张数据表的“查询” 112

10.6 专家指点 116

10.7 思考题 117

第11章 设计与使用“一对多表单” 118

11.1 启动One-to-Many Form Wizard 118

11.2 从父表中选择字段 119

11.3 从子表中选定字段 120

11.4 选择匹配字段 120

11.5 排列“表单”中的记录顺序 121

11.6 保存与预览“一对多表单” 121

11.7 修改“一对多表单” 122

11.9 思考题 126

11.8 专家指点 126

第12章 设计与使用“一对多报表” 127

12.1 设计“一对多报表” 127

12.2 选择字段的方法 128

12.3 保存与预览“一对多报表” 129

12.4 控制显示工具栏 130

12.5 设置“数据环境” 131

12.7 在“报表”中插入图片 132

12.6 设计报表的标题 132

12.8 排布“报表”中的内容 134

12.9 设置“报表”文字属性 136

12.10 在“报表”中添加新的数据 137

12.11 在报表中绘制图形 138

12.12 专家指点 139

12.13 思考题 140

第13章 设计与使用“交叉表查询”和“图形查询” 141

13.1 交叉表查询 142

13.2 设计“图形查询” 145

13.4 思考题 147

13.3 专家指点 147

第3篇 公司管理系统数据库开发实例 148

第14章 制定数据库系统的主程序 148

14.1 控制程序 149

14.2 设置日期表达方式 152

14.3 制定操作窗口的显示形式 154

14.4 制定操作窗口与标题 156

14.5 设置程序位置与入口 157

14.7 专家指点 160

14.6 设置主程序 160

14.8 思考题 161

第15章 制定数据库系统的登录窗口 163

15.1 制定授权使用者列表 163

15.2 制定对话框中的说明文本 166

15.3 复制并创建新的对象 169

15.4 应用相对位置对齐功能 170

15.5 设计文本框 172

15.6 设计命令按钮 174

15.7 制定单击按钮后的任务 175

15.8 设计表单的运行方式 178

15.9 专家指点 181

15.10 思考题 181

第16章 制定数据库系统的操作菜单 183

16.1 制定下拉菜单结构 183

16.2 了解Visual FoxPro的下拉菜单 185

16.3 设计下拉菜单 187

16.4 设计菜单中命令的访问键 188

16.5 设计命令的快捷键 189

16.6 设置初始化与清理代码 191

16.7 生成菜单程序 192

16.8 专家指点 193

16.9 思考题 194

第17章 设计与应用工具栏 195

17.1 使用“类”与“子类” 195

17.2 定义新类的时机 196

17.3 设计新的类 197

17.4 设计按钮的单击动作 201

17.5 从表单中创建类 203

17.6 为使用类定义而注册它 205

17.7 制定类的定义信息与图标 206

17.8 浏览类库与类 207

17.9 专家指点 208

17.10 思考题 208

第18章 设计库房管理子系统 209

18.1 制定库房管理主程序 209

18.3 设计表单标题栏 211

18.2 制定库房管理者信息 211

18.4 用表中的记录创建表单控件 212

18.5 绘制入库单表格 214

18.6 填充标签与文本框 216

18.7 预设可选文本 218

18.8 保存入库单 219

18.9 专家指点 222

18.10 思考题 222

第19章 设计库房管理子系统操作窗口 223

19.1 查询指定品名或类别的货物 223

19.2 制定“货物明细表” 226

19.3 在表单中设计表格 227

19.4 控制表单中的显示内容 229

19.5 设计选项组按钮 233

19.6 应用按钮选项组 235

19.7 打印库存明细表 238

19.8 专家指点 238

19.9 思考题 239

第20章 设计“客户资料管理系统”主程序及主界面 240

第4篇 客户管理系统数据库开发实例 240

20.1 设计主程序 241

20.2 在表单中设计背景图像 242

20.3 添加背景音乐 244

20.4 制定程序的版权信息 245

20.5 设计Web页面风格的表单 246

20.6 设计控件的功能注释文本 249

20.7 快速设计按钮与注释文本 252

20.8 控制显示主操作窗口 254

20.9 专家指点 255

20.10 思考题 256

第21章 设计浏览资料表单 257

21.1 在系统分析中制定表结构 257

21.2 导入纯文本文件来创建表 258

21.3 制定客户资料数据库 263

21.4 向数据库添加表 265

21.5 制作客户资料浏览表单 266

21.6 快速制作按钮组 269

21.7 修改按钮组 271

21.8 设置按钮的快捷键 273

21.9 专家指点 274

21.10 思考题 275

第22章 制定“客户资料管理系统”各模块功能 276

22.1 应用矩形控件 276

22.2 设计控件的显示特效 280

22.3 设计表单功能 283

22.4 专家指点 291

22.5 思考题 291

第5篇 调试与编译数据库应用系统 292

第23章 调试与编译应用程序 292

23.1 启动调试器 293

23.2 控制显示子窗口 294

23.3 跟踪程序或表单 294

23.4 控制断点类型 297

23.5 查看与修改当前值 299

23.6 跟踪事件与处理错误 300

23.7 编译应用程序 301

23.8 专家指点 302

23.9 思考题 303

第6篇 网络销售管理系统数据库开发实例第24章 设计“网络销售管理系统”主程序及主界面 304

24.1 设计多用户访问入口 305

24.2 设计应用程序的运行方式 308

24.3 设计结束操作程序 310

24.4 设计信息表 311

24.5 制定产品信息系统主程序 313

24.6 设计产品信息菜单栏 318

24.7 专家指点 319

24.8 思考题 319

25.1 定义关系数据库 320

第25章 设计管理产品信息模块 320

25.2 应用关系数据库设计表单 322

25.3 设计表格标题 324

25.4 设计“产品信息总揽”功能 326

25.5 在表单中设计选项卡 328

25.6 设计备份产品信息功能 330

25.7 设计数据恢复功能 333

25.8 专家指点 335

25.9 思考题 336

26.1 设计主操作窗口 337

第26章 设计产品销售模块 337

26.2 设计连网销售表 339

26.3 设计本地视图 341

26.4 设计网络浏览功能 342

26.5 创建定货表 345

26.6 设计在线定货功能 348

26.7 专家指点 350

26.8 思考题 351

27.1 为升迁做好准备工作 352

第27章 将数据库上传到服务器 352

27.2 设置SQL服务器 354

27.3 制定升迁 355

27.4 专家指点 362

27.5 思考题 362

第7篇 开发商业数据库系统的后期工作 363

第28章 设计并制作在线帮助 363

28.1 准备相关文档 364

28.3 创建帮助项目 367

28.2 安装与运行相关软件 367

28.4 制定项目内容 370

28.5 创建帮助目录 372

28.6 设计在线帮助索引 375

28.7 添加搜索功能 376

28.8 编译在线帮助文件 377

28.9 专家指点 378

28.10 思考题 378

第29章 设计并制作安装程序 380

29.1 选择Install Shield版本 380

29.3 建立安装程序项目 382

29.2 准备相关文件 382

29.4 制定应用程序信息 384

29.5 指定安装的操作系统与所请求的其他应用软件 385

29.6 制定安装类型 386

29.7 为安装选项制定安装文件 387

29.8 定义启动应用程序的快捷方式 389

29.9 设计安装程序的对话内容 391

29.10 建立安装程序 392

29.11 专家指点 392

29.12 思考题 393

第30章 设计与制作图标 394

30.1 应用程序图标设计原则 394

30.2 使用专用工具设计与制作图标 396

30.3 将图像文件转换成图标文件 397

30.4 更换可执行文件的图标 399

30.5 专家指点 401

30.6 思考题 402

附录A 安装与运行Visual FoxPro 403

附录B Visual FoxPro常用命令、函数、操作符、对象、属性、事件和方法速查 407